Title

步骤:
1.挂载磁盘
2.安装jdk1.8
3.安装mysql5.7
4.导入数据库
5.防火墙端口放行
5.运行jar文件

1.挂载磁盘
https://www.cnblogs.com/xiang96/p/10240207.html
2.安装jdk1.8
https://www.cnblogs.com/lysc/p/12522959.html
3.安装mysql5.7
https://www.cnblogs.com/lysc/p/12522940.html
4.导入数据库
1、首先建空数据库
mysql>create database dbname charset=utf8;

2、导入数据库
方法一(终端登陆mysql后):
(1)选择数据库
mysql>use dbname ;
(2)设置数据库编码
mysql>set names utf8;
(3)导入数据(注意sql文件的路径)
mysql>source /home/xxxx/dbname .sql;
方法二(终端直接输入):
mysql -u用户名 -p密码 数据库名 < 数据库名.sql (注意sql文件的路径)
5.防火墙端口放行
firewall-cmd --permanent --add-port=8080/tcp
firewall-cmd --permanent --add-port=3306/tcp
5.运行jar文件
执行 cd 文件夹路径 命令进入jar包所在文件夹
后台运行jar包:执行 nohup java -jar ***.jar &(nohub 表示后台不挂断运行)
如需将日志输出到指定文件,在&前面加上>***.log ,如下:nohup java -jar test-admin.jar >out.log &

命令汇总

开启数据库:systemctl start mysqld.service
关闭数据库:systemctl stop mysqld.service
重启数据库:systemctl restart mysqld.service
数据库状态:systemctl status mysqld.service

启动防火墙:systemctl start firewalld
停止防火墙: systemctl disable firewalld
禁用防火墙:systemctl stop firewalld
重启防火墙:systemctl restart firewalld或者firewall-cmd --reload
防火墙状态:systemctl status firewalld
查看端口:netstat -lnp|grep 80
开启端口:firewall-cmd --permanent --add-port=80/tcp (--permanent代表永久生效不需重启)
firewall-cmd --zone=public --add-port=80/tcp --permanent
查看端口是否开启:firewall-cmd --query-port=80/tcp
查看开启的端口:firewall-cmd --list-port
查看进程:ps -ef|grep java
结束进程:kill -9 PID

Linux启动jar(nohub 表示后台不挂断运行):nohup java -jar ***.jar &
启动jar包,日志输出到指定文件:nohup java -jar ***.jar >***.log &

posted on 2020-03-19 11:01  闫世超  阅读(481)  评论(0编辑  收藏  举报
Title